AIMS of the Course

FAS is a new aligner system that was created and developed by Doctors Domingo Martin and Alberto Canabez to bring function and excellence to the world of aligners. The system allows clinicians to finish their cases with excellent occlusion, fewer aligners and minimal refinements.

The number of FAS Aligners will vary in relation to the complexity of each case and the recommended treatment plan. The present course will demonstrate with several clinical cases the use of FAS Aligners in mixed dentitions, to correct anterior cross bites, lateral cross bites relieve crowdings and redirect the harmonious development of the arches.
Also, the use of FAS Aligners in teens during permanent dentition will be shown, as alternative to Twin Blocks/Functional appliances to correct Class II malocclusions, cross bites, and deep overbites.

Finally the Hybrid FAS Aligner/2D Lingual concept will be discussed for the invisible treatments of adults. In fact, very challenging malocclusions may need additional FAS Aligners after the initial series of Aligners is completed, or they could be finalized with the help of 2D Lingual brackets. Because tooth movement is subject to individual biological factors, the system cannot guarantee complete achievement of the difficult movements and additional aligners and/or techniques such as lingual braces, skeletal anchorage and additional intermaxillary elastics may be necessary to achieve the proposed goal. The combined use of 2D Lingual braces together with FAS Aligners will optimize the treatment outcome and reduce the number of appointments, especially in specific clinical situations like severe rotational control, alignment of impacted canines, torque control and management of gingival recessions, angulation control and root uprighting.

FAS Kids

80% of orthodontic treatments could be avoided if treated at early ages before the malocclusion sets in. FAS KIDS aims to maintain or restore the natural functional balance of the mouth and the rest of the body in growing patients. FAS Kids aligner treatment is especially designed to correct patients’ malocclusions, both in primary as in mixed dentition, that is between 5 and 12 years old. Thanks to 3D technology FAS Kids aligners are custom made and are adapted as the patient grows.
FAS Kids aligners are made with a special material that adapts perfectly to the dental anatomy, thus avoiding discomfort of conventional devices.

FKA (fas kids aligners) are a real alternative to conventional treatment of orthodontic problems in growing patients since they are really comfortable, they do not cause wounds or sores, they reduce the risk of cavities, facilitate patient hygiene, allow them to be removed to eat, do not make speech difficult, reduce the risk of dental fractures and increase the patient
self-esteem.
